I still run 2.1-1 with Velocity .4 because my USB is buggy on my phone, and the screen is cracked so I can't get it replaced. My youtube works as long as I don't try to login to my account. As soon as I login, I get consistent force closes and the only way to get it to stop is to format my phone and reinstall the rom. Maybe that might help you. Don't try to login, it will never work, never has for me anyway.
 
Some websites, like funnyordie.com run their videos through the default video player. If you are looking for comedy that's your best best, I'm not sure about music.

Dont have to wipe all data and reflash, just go into application settings and wipe the data for just the youtube app. It will forget your login info and you'll be good to go.
